Latest Patents

Hall holds a patent for an orthopedic bandage, which describes a casting or splinting material presented in powder form. This invention is a mixture comprising a water-soluble cross-linkable polymer, containing carboxylic acid groups, such as polyacrylic acid, and zinc oxide or other zinc salts. Notably, these materials are at least partially coated to minimize their reactivity with organic acids, enhancing their usability. The invention can be delivered as a slurry in a volatile organic liquid, particularly for coating on Leno gauze, lending flexibility to the application process.
